Transaction 3999b2374de1e4b3e30bdcd27af12f5019bbf407ff030e7748a86cd26d0d9e5e

1 Input
2 Outputs
  • 3999b2374de1e4b3e30bdcd27af12f5019bbf407ff030e7748a86cd26d0d9e5e:0
  • value  20000000
    address  158mZ1KbRzBV5mjzrUxtez5Uwfir2aTPWK
  • 3999b2374de1e4b3e30bdcd27af12f5019bbf407ff030e7748a86cd26d0d9e5e:1
  • value  69868923
    address  1LeDA6UpCcYSZ8UdF2uznTt4RYQ7hYUW3b